How PayID Moves Money Between Your Bank and the Casino

online casino that use payid in Australia — How PayID Moves Money Between Your Bank and the Casino

PayID runs on the New Payments Platform (NPP), the real-time rail built by Australian banks in 2018. Unlike card payments, which bounce through acquiring banks and payment processors, NPP transfers settle directly between accounts in near real time, 24 hours a day, seven days a week — including weekends and public holidays. That is why the method has become the backbone of online gambling Australia-wide: there is no banking "cut-off" to miss and no batch settlement to wait for.

The deposit flow, step by step

  1. You open the casino's cashier and choose PayID as your deposit method.
  2. You enter the amount — typically a A$20 minimum — and the casino's PayID identifier or Osko reference.
  3. Your banking app sends the payment via NPP, and it lands in the casino's account within seconds to a few minutes.
  4. The casino credits your balance, usually automatically once the payment reference matches your player account.

On the withdrawal side the flow reverses, with one important difference: the casino's finance team usually applies a pending window — anywhere from instant to 48 hours — before releasing funds to the NPP network. Once released, the money hits your bank account in seconds. The casino's pending period, not the payment rail, is nearly always the bottleneck.

Where PayID beats cards and bank wires

Card deposits are instant but card withdrawals can take three to five business days, because Visa and Mastercard payouts travel through batch settlement. International wire transfers are slower still — often five to ten business days and A$25 or more in fees. PayID compresses both legs of the journey to minutes, which is precisely why the best Australian PayID casino sites have made it their headline banking option.

Setting Up PayID With Your Australian Bank

You do not need a separate app or account to use PayID — it is a feature of your existing bank account. Nearly every major Australian institution supports it: the big four, plus Macquarie, ING, Up, Bankwest and most regional banks. Setup takes about two minutes inside your banking app.

Registering your identifier

Open your banking app, find the PayID section (usually under settings or payments), and register either your mobile number or your email address against your transaction account. You can hold more than one PayID if you like — many people register both. Once registered, the identifier works across every service that accepts NPP payments, from the casino cashier to splitting a dinner bill.

What you will need at the casino

When you deposit, the casino will show you its receiving PayID (a phone number or email) and ask you to include a reference code matching your player account. Copy that reference exactly — an unmatched reference is the single most common cause of a delayed deposit. Withdrawals are simpler: the casino sends funds to your registered PayID, so the money lands in the same bank account you registered from the start. One practical note: keep your registered PayID current. If you change mobile numbers and forget to update it in your banking app, a withdrawal sent to the old identifier can bounce and add days to your payout while the casino re-processes it. Bonuses at a PayID Casino

Bonuses are where the marketing gloss is thickest, so it pays to read the fine print before opting in. A welcome package that looks enormous on the banner can carry wagering requirements that make it nearly impossible to convert into withdrawable cash.

Wagering requirements, translated into plain numbers

A 100% match bonus up to A$500 with 40x wagering means you must stake A$20,000 before the bonus funds convert to real money. At an average pokie with 96% RTP, the expected cost of clearing that wagering is roughly A$800 — more than the bonus itself. Offers with 20–30x wagering are materially fairer; anything above 45x is best treated as entertainment budget, not withdrawable value. Game weighting and other fine print

Table games frequently contribute just 10–20% toward wagering, and some progressive jackpot pokies contribute nothing at all. Maximum bet limits while wagering — commonly A$5–A$10 per spin — are enforced strictly, and breaching them can void your winnings. Read the game-weighting table before you claim, not after. Fees and Payout Speeds Compared

online casino that use payid in Australia — Fees and Payout Speeds Compared

This is where the money actually leaks, so let's put hard numbers on it. The comparison table above lists payout windows; this section explains what those windows mean in practice and what each leg of the journey costs.

The real cost of a PayID transaction

The NPP network itself charges nothing to the player — PayID transfers are free at virtually every Australian bank. The costs, when they exist, come from the casino side: some operators apply a flat fee on withdrawals below a threshold (typically A$2.50–A$5 on cashouts under A$50), and a small number cap free withdrawals at a certain number per month. Currency conversion is a non-issue when the casino banks in AUD, but offshore operators settling in USD or EUR can add a 2–3% margin through exchange rates. Check the cashier's currency field before your first deposit; a site that displays your balance in A$ from the moment you register has already answered that question. Speed benchmarks: what the windows mean

Instant–12 hours
automated or near-automated approval; your withdrawal often clears inside a single coffee break.
1–24 hours
manual review during business hours; submitted on a weekday morning, it typically clears the same day.
Up to 48 hours
batched processing; fine for patient players, but you will feel the wait on a Friday evening request.

Two things reliably slow a payout regardless of the operator: an unverified account and an active bonus. Completing KYC before your first withdrawal — not during it — removes the largest single delay, and finishing or forfeiting wagering requirements prevents the support-desk back-and-forth that follows a prematurely requested cashout. Players who want to skip document checks entirely sometimes explore a no ID verification withdrawal casino Australia has in its offshore corners, but our honest advice is to verify once and never think about it again: legitimate sites keep documents secure, and verified accounts withdraw faster forever after.

When a bigger withdrawal changes the maths

Most operators process standard withdrawals (up to roughly A$5,000–A$10,000) through their automated pipeline, but larger sums trigger manual review, and some sites split big payouts into weekly instalments — a A$50,000 cashout on a weekly A$7,500 cap takes nearly seven weeks to fully clear. If you play at stakes where five-figure sessions are plausible, read the withdrawal limit section of the terms before you deposit, not after you hit the jackpot. PayID Casino FAQ

Is PayID safe to use at online casinos? Yes. PayID is not a wallet or a third-party processor — it is a direct transfer between your bank account and the casino's account over the NPP, the same regulated network your bank uses for everyday payments. Your card details are never shared with the casino, and every transfer is protected by your bank's own security and fraud monitoring. The residual risk lies not with PayID itself but with the operator on the other end, which is why the licensing and terms checks above matter more than the payment method. Do all Australian banks support PayID? Effectively, yes. More than 100 Australian financial institutions — covering over 90% of transaction accounts — support PayID through the NPP. That includes the major banks (CBA, Westpac, NAB, ANZ), Macquarie, ING, Up, Bankwest and most credit unions. If your banking app has a "PayID" or "Osko" option in its payment settings, you are set. A handful of smaller institutions may limit PayID to certain account types, so check with your bank if the option is not visible. How long do PayID withdrawals actually take? The transfer itself is seconds — the NPP settles in near real time. The variable part is the casino's pending window, which ranges from instant (fully automated approval) to 48 hours (batched manual review) across the operators on this page. Your first withdrawal is nearly always the slowest, because identity verification and payment-method confirmation happen at that point; subsequent payouts from a verified account typically run at the fast end of the operator's published range. Are there fees for using PayID at casinos? The payment method itself is free — Australian banks do not charge for PayID transfers in either direction. Fees, where they exist, come from the casino: occasional flat fees on small withdrawals, exchange-rate margins at operators that do not bank in AUD, or limits on the number of free cashouts per month. Every operator in our comparison table banks in AUD for Australian players, so currency conversion is not a cost you should be absorbing at any site featured here.
